CONTEXT

ICRC has the ambition to build effective and efficient delivery systems through a Global Shared Service (GSS) model to enable the delivery of its strategy focused on beneficiaries and partners.

Since 1993, ICRC has offshored activities, mainly from the ICRC headquarters, starting with the Philippines and has added new activities, year by year, across the world. In 2016, the activities were regrouped under the Corporate Service Network (CSN) umbrella. These CSNs are spread across 27 delegations and have developed different types of activities under different delivery models, each with a different maturity level. The Institution would like to now build a more integrated structure called GSS to increase the quality of the services, expand the scope and leverage the scale effect through increased automation.

In 2020, the ICRC launched a programme which aims to build a Global Shared Service (GSS) structure by leveraging the CSN and similar shared services that already exist in the organization.

The programme aims to:

  • Implement the future operating model and governance
  • Define the guidance and fundamental operational elements of the service delivery models
  • Propose a location strategy and build regional hubs
  • Define the HR strategy for all staff impacted and ensure a relevant HR process is set up to develop the GSS
  • Revise the financial model to reinforce the accountabilities of the different parties
  • Implement projects aimed at transitioning current shared services centres.
  • The team is currently split into three locations: Geneva, Belgrade, and Nairobi.
